MoSSe@reduced Graphene Oxide Nanocomposite Heterostructures as Efficient and Stable Electrocatalysts for the Hydrogen Evolution Reaction   Original Research Article
Nano Energy, Available online 20 April 2016, Pages
Bharathi Konkena, Justus Masa, Wei Xia, Martin Muhler, Wolfgang. Schuhmann

Graphical abstract

By taking advantage of the electrostatic attraction between the two oppositely charged nanosheets, MoSSe@rGO composite materials are obtained exhibiting superior electrocatalytic activity and stability for the HER allowing a current density of 5 mAcm−2 at a low overpotential of only 135mV.

Effect of catalyst loading on hydrogen storage capacity of ZIF-8/graphene oxide doped with Pt or Pd via spillover   Original Research Article
Microporous and Mesoporous Materials, Available online 19 April 2016, Pages
Hu Zhou, Jian Zhang, Dong Ji, Aihua Yuan, Xiaoping Shen

Graphical abstract

The significantly improved hydrogen storage capacities at 298 K were observed in Pt or Pd doped ZIF-8/GO with varying catalyst loadings due to the spillover effect. The uniform catalyst dispersion and moderate loading facilitated the spillover process.
